M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
that
addresses
issues
relevant to open
educational resources
(OER) and
massive open online courses (MOOCs).
The latest
advancements in
digital education technology have provided the means for
humans
all around the world
to participate in courses via the Internet.
These online MOOC courses are
almost always free
for learners but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
